Y = -2x +19
solve for x

2 Answers

6 votes

Answer:


x=(19)/(2) -(y)/(2)=9.5-0.5y

Explanation:

  1. Original equation:
    y=-2x+19
  2. Add 2x on both sides:
    2x+y=19
  3. Subtract y on both sides:
    2x=19-y
  4. Divide both sides of the equation by 2:
    x=(19)/(2)-(y)/(2)=9.5-0.5y
  5. Done!
